Healdsburg, CA (October 13, 2025) – A late-night crash in Healdsburg left three people seriously injured after a car struck a power pole and went down an embankment, according to officials.
According to the California Highway Patrol, the accident occurred on Saturday night, October 12, at approximately 10:41 p.m. near the intersection of Bailhache Avenue and Toyon Drive. A Ford Mustang reportedly veered off the roadway and crashed into a power pole, then tumbled down an embankment.
Emergency crews arrived at the scene and found three individuals trapped inside the wreckage. Firefighters worked to extricate the victims before they were transported to a nearby hospital with serious injuries.
Authorities are still working to determine the cause of the crash. It is not yet clear if speed, impairment, or mechanical failure played a role.
